“Prosecutors Form ‘FAFO’ Team to Target Lawbreaking Federal Agents”
In response to rising concerns surrounding federal enforcement tactics, a coalition known as the “FAFO” team has been established. This initiative focuses on addressing unlawful actions carried out by federal agents, including warrantless entries and unlawful detentions.
Formation and Purpose of the FAFO Team
The FAFO coalition aims to enforce constitutional limitations on federal authority through lawful channels. Its primary goals include:
- Sharing strategies and best practices among legal professionals.
- Providing public updates on efforts to curb unlawful federal actions.
- Educating the public on available legal recourse.
- Coordinating accountability efforts across different jurisdictions.
Key Members of the Coalition
This coalition is spearheaded by a group of influential district attorneys. Some of the prominent members include:
- Larry Krasner from Philadelphia
- José Garza from Austin, Texas
- Laura Conover from Pima County, Arizona
Increasing Concerns Over Federal Actions
The launch of the FAFO team comes amid growing scrutiny of federal agents’ operations in various cities. Recently, federal immigration agents have made their presence felt in:
- Washington, D.C.
- Memphis, Tennessee
- Los Angeles, California
- Minneapolis, Minnesota
In one alarming incident, federal agents shot and killed two individuals, Renee Good and Alex Pretti, in Minneapolis. These events have been characterized by door-to-door raids and the detention of young children, raising serious safety and ethical concerns.
Challenges Ahead for FAFO
Although the FAFO group has been formed with the intent to challenge federal misconduct, it remains uncertain whether it can successfully hold federal agents accountable for abuses of power.
